/* * Match and parse a config key of the form: * * section.(subsection.)?key * * (i.e., what gets handed to a config_fn_t). The caller provides the section; * we return -1 if it does not match, 0 otherwise. The subsection and key * out-parameters are filled by the function (and *subsection is NULL if it is * missing). * * If the subsection pointer-to-pointer passed in is NULL, returns 0 only if * there is no subsection at all. */ extern int parse_config_key(const char *var, const char *section, const char **subsection, int *subsection_len, const char **key);
